If you’ve never been to Lush then you’ve definitely smelt it. The handmade cosmetics emporium is well known for its super smelly shops, fizzing bath bombs and solid shampoo bars, and now they’ve opened their new biggest store on Oxford Street.
I went along to the opening to see all three floors of glittery goodness…
The new shop is HUGE (9500 square ft.) and each product range has been extensively added to with more than 200 new items for the launch.
A Lush Spa with four treatment rooms can be found down in the basement where you can try new products before you buy in the Hair Lab, and learn more about the industry from experts with an array of regular talks and workshops.
“Opening this stunning store in central London is the icing on Lush’s 20th birthday cake,” says Lush’s co-founder and Managing Director, Mark Constantine OBE.
“Sometimes folk forget how different Lush is from other cosmetic companies. We invent what we make in a very un-inventive industry; we make fresh products with no or limited preservatives in an industry geared up to keep products for years and years before they are sold.”